Abstract

This study aims to determine the effect of various concentrations of fermented rice washing water on the growth and yield of cauliflower plant. The research was carried out at the Field Laboratory of Experimental Gardens II, Faculty of Agriculture, Halu Oleo University, Kendari, from July to September 2021. The study used a Randomized Block Design (RBD) consisting of six treatments, namely Control (P0), POC 20 mL/L(P1), POC 40 mL/L (P2), POC 60 mL/L (P3), POC 80 mL/L (P4) and POC 100 mL/L (P5). Each treatment was repeated three times so that there were 18 experimental units. The variables observed were plant height, number of leaves and weight of flower mass. The results showed that the application of various concentrations of fermented rice washing water could increase the growth and yield of cauliflower plants. The best treatment was obtained at POC concentration of 40 mL/L with a plant height of 11.83 cm, flowermass weight of 35.05 g. Whereas the highest number of leaves was obtained in the 60 mL/L (P3) treatment.
